  • Abstract
    A novel printed octagonal fractal micro-strip antenna with semi-elliptical ground plane is presented for ultra wide band applications. The proposed antenna has a compact size of 20×20×1 mm³. The measured result of the antenna exhibits the ultra-wide band characteristics from 2/9 to 14/2 GHz. In this paper, reducing antenna’s size by 35%, the same results were achieved, while small dimension fractal micro-strip antenna is presented. The antenna’s size is 15×12×1 mm³ which has a small and appropriate size for nowadays’ telecommunication systems and utilization. The design and simulation results of micro-strip patch fractal antennas using Ansoft HFSS is presented and discussed below.
